AFBytes Brief

OpenAI and Anthropic together have hired nearly 100 employees from Salesforce since the start of 2026. LinkedIn profiles document the moves.

Why this matters

Rapid movement of experienced enterprise software talent into frontier AI labs can accelerate product development timelines and change competitive dynamics in cloud and CRM markets.
